1. What is Gimp ?
Gimp is a cross platform image editor available for GNU/Linux,OS X,Windows and more operating systems. It's a free software where you can change it's source code and distribute and distribute your changes to it.
Whether you are a graphic designer, photographer, illustrator, or scientist, GIMP provides you with sophisticated tools to get your job done. You can further enhance your productivity with GIMP thanks to many customization options and 3rd party plugins.
